Connie Cezon was born on March 28, 1925 in Oakland, California, USA as Consuelo Lord Cezon. She is known for her work on Corny Casanovas (1952), Perry Mason (1957) and Female Jungle (1955). She died on February 26, 2004 in Glendale, California.
